Output 68a88dba3abc9aece197e0483fe3023d1b5e858ae5160a0dda008a51b224f56c:4

value
4200000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42935b8ff843b048d2e14127402988992e6afa53 OP_EQUALVERIFY OP_CHECKSIG
address
17528FZ3a4fXsc1sw3TvFAhddpDK9cDsdW
transaction
68a88dba3abc9aece197e0483fe3023d1b5e858ae5160a0dda008a51b224f56c
spent
true